Former Hammer and Skipper Kevin Nolan has been relieved of his managerial duties at Leyton Orient but will remain as a player at least until the end of the season

Leyton Orient  released an Official Statement:

Following inaccurate reports in the media today, Alessandro Angelieri, the Club’s CEO, has issued the following statement:

“Everyone at the Club is fighting hard to make sure we reach the play-offs this season. Whilst that aim remains within reach, we have decided that Kevin should focus entirely on his playing contribution until the end of the season.

“We believe that Kevin will be able to make a bigger impact on the team without the distraction of managerial duties.

“Andy Hessenthaler, who has been assisting Kevin over the past few months, will take charge of the first team in the interim.”

Another former Hammer Ian Hendon was sacked by Leyton Orient back in mid-January after a string of defeats. Nolan was Orient’s fifth manager in under two years.
